Getting Started With Your Design

The first step to using online 3D print services is having your 3D model ready. There are plenty of free and paid CAD software out there that you can use to bring your creation to life, such as Tinkercad, Blender, and SolidWorks. Most 3D print services accept STL, OBJ, or 3MF file formats.

Understanding Your Materials

Each 3D print material has its pros and cons. Certain materials like ABS and PLA are commonly used due to their ease of printing and durability. Other materials like resin, PETG, and nylon offer more strength and flexibility and can be used for more specific applications.

Navigating Through the Print Process

After choosing the material and the service, you'll have to upload your 3D model to the platform. Various parameters such as layer thickness, orientation, and infill density can be tweaked as per your requirement. These settings will significantly impact the strength, finish, and print time of your product.

3D printing materials

Plastics

One of the most commonly used 3D printing materials. These materials include ABS, PLA, PETG, TPU, PEEK, etc. Each material has different physical and chemical properties and can be suitable for different application scenarios.

Metal

Metal 3D printing materials include titanium alloy, aluminum alloy, stainless steel, nickel alloy, etc. Metal 3D printing can produce complex components and molds, with advantages such as high strength and high wear resistance.

Ceramic

Ceramic 3D printing materials include alumina, zirconia, silicate, etc. Ceramic 3D printing can produce high-precision ceramic products, such as ceramic parts, ceramic sculptures, etc.
